True. If you haven't missed a day of smoking in a long time the dreams are way too strange and intense.
If i may? Try to see it as an opportunity to learn something about yourself, trust me, you will.
To interpret it, just freely associate the elements in the dream, don't rely on this esoteric stuff/books about dreams.
Example: In your dream you see an albino elephant eating pizza.
Just let your mind flow, what comes to mind if you think about:
Albino
Elephant
Pizza
Eating
One by one...it will become clear and in the end, it's not to hard to string it together.
Had quiet a few bad dreams(sweating, screaming, pure horror ect.) myself, but now i look forward to them because it's so damn interesting and you will learn things about yourself you would NEVER have learned otherwise.
